#fbe158 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fbe158 is composed of 98.4% red, 88.2% green and 34.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 10.4% magenta, 64.9%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 50.4 degrees, a saturation of 95.3% and a lightness of 66.5%. #fbe158 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ffb0 with #f7c300.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c66.

#fbe158 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#fbe158 has RGB values of R:251, G:225, B:88 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.1, Y:0.65,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 16507224.
